excel怎么拆开两个文档

excel怎么拆开两个文档

在Excel中拆分两个文档的方法有多种,包括使用复制粘贴、导入数据功能、VBA宏等,这些方法都可以高效地将一个Excel文档拆分成两个独立的文档。 其中,复制粘贴是一种最为简单、直观的方法,适用于数据量较小的情况。下面将详细介绍这一方法。

一、复制粘贴方法

复制粘贴方法是最为直接的一种拆分方式,适用于数据量较小且不需要复杂操作的情况。步骤如下:

  1. 打开源文档和目标文档
    首先,打开你需要拆分的Excel文档(源文档)和一个新的Excel文档(目标文档)。

  2. 选择数据区域
    在源文档中,选择需要拆分到新文档的数据区域。可以使用鼠标拖动选择,或者使用快捷键“Ctrl + A”全选整个工作表。

  3. 复制数据
    选定数据后,右键点击选择“复制”,或者使用快捷键“Ctrl + C”。

  4. 粘贴数据到目标文档
    切换到目标文档,选择一个空白的工作表区域,右键点击选择“粘贴”,或者使用快捷键“Ctrl + V”。这样,数据就被复制到了新文档中。

二、导入数据功能

如果需要拆分的数据量较大,或需要将数据从一个文档中的多个工作表拆分到多个文档中,可以使用Excel的导入数据功能。

  1. 准备源数据文件
    确保需要拆分的源数据文件已经保存,并且包含所有需要拆分的数据。

  2. 打开目标文档
    打开一个新的Excel文档,作为目标文档。

  3. 使用导入数据功能
    在目标文档中,点击“数据”选项卡,然后选择“获取数据”或“导入数据”选项。根据具体的Excel版本不同,操作可能有所差异。

  4. 选择源数据文件
    在弹出的对话框中,浏览并选择源数据文件。选择需要导入的数据工作表或数据区域。

  5. 完成导入
    按照导入向导的提示,完成数据导入操作。这种方法适用于需要从多个工作表导入数据的情况。

三、使用VBA宏

对于需要定期进行大量数据拆分的用户,可以通过编写VBA宏来实现自动化操作。VBA宏可以极大地提高工作效率,并减少手动操作中的错误。

  1. 打开Excel VBA编辑器
    在Excel中按下“Alt + F11”打开VBA编辑器。

  2. 插入新模块
    在VBA编辑器中,点击“插入”菜单,然后选择“模块”以插入一个新的VBA模块。

  3. 编写VBA代码
    在新模块中编写VBA代码,以实现数据拆分的功能。以下是一个简单的示例代码:

Sub SplitWorkbook()

Dim ws As Worksheet

Dim newWb As Workbook

For Each ws In ThisWorkbook.Worksheets

ws.Copy

Set newWb = ActiveWorkbook

newWb.SaveAs ThisWorkbook.Path & "" & ws.Name & ".xlsx"

newWb.Close False

Next ws

End Sub

  1. 运行宏
    保存并运行宏,代码会将当前工作簿中的每个工作表拆分成一个新的工作簿,并保存到与源文件相同的目录下。

四、文件链接与合并

在某些情况下,你可能需要将一个Excel文档中的数据拆分到多个文档中,同时保持这些文档之间的链接。可以通过创建外部链接来实现这一点。

  1. 创建新文档
    打开一个新的Excel文档,作为目标文档。

  2. 建立链接
    在目标文档中,选择一个单元格,输入等号“=”,然后切换到源文档,选择需要链接的数据单元格。按下“Enter”键后,目标文档中的单元格会显示源文档中的数据,并保持实时更新。

  3. 复制链接
    如果需要链接多个数据区域,可以重复上述步骤,或者使用Excel的拖动填充功能快速复制链接。

  4. 保存文档
    最后,将目标文档保存为新文件。这样,即使将数据拆分到多个文档中,仍然可以保持数据的一致性和实时更新。

五、使用第三方工具

有些第三方工具和插件可以帮助你更高效地拆分Excel文档。这些工具通常提供更为丰富的功能和更友好的界面,适用于需要经常进行文档拆分的用户。

  1. 选择合适的工具
    根据你的需求,选择一款适合的第三方工具。常见的工具有Kutools for Excel等。

  2. 安装工具
    下载并安装所选工具。安装过程通常非常简单,只需按照提示操作即可。

  3. 使用工具进行拆分
    打开需要拆分的Excel文档,启动第三方工具,根据工具的功能选项进行操作。通常,这些工具会提供详细的操作向导,帮助你快速完成文档拆分。

六、Excel的Power Query功能

Excel的Power Query功能也可以用于拆分文档,尤其适用于需要进行复杂数据处理的情况。

  1. 打开Power Query编辑器
    在Excel中,点击“数据”选项卡,然后选择“获取数据”或“Power Query编辑器”。

  2. 导入源数据
    在Power Query编辑器中,选择“从文件”或其他数据源,导入需要拆分的数据。

  3. 拆分数据
    使用Power Query编辑器提供的各种功能,如筛选、拆分列、分组等,将数据拆分成多个查询。

  4. 加载数据到新文档
    完成数据拆分后,将每个查询加载到新的Excel工作表中。最后保存为新的Excel文档。

总结

复制粘贴、导入数据功能、VBA宏、文件链接与合并、使用第三方工具、Excel的Power Query功能都是在Excel中拆分两个文档的有效方法。根据具体的需求和数据量,可以选择最适合的方法来高效地完成文档拆分工作。

相关问答FAQs:

1. 为什么我需要拆开两个Excel文档?

拆开两个Excel文档可以帮助您更好地管理和处理数据。当您有两个包含大量数据的Excel文档时,拆开它们可以使您更容易对数据进行比较、分析和处理。

2. 我该如何拆开两个Excel文档?

要拆开两个Excel文档,您可以采取以下步骤:

  • 打开第一个Excel文档。
  • 在Excel窗口的任务栏上单击鼠标右键,并选择“打开新窗口”选项。
  • 在新打开的Excel窗口中,打开第二个Excel文档。
  • 现在,您可以同时在两个窗口中查看和编辑两个Excel文档。

3. 如何在两个拆开的Excel文档之间进行数据复制和粘贴?

要在两个拆开的Excel文档之间复制和粘贴数据,您可以按照以下步骤操作:

  • 在第一个Excel文档中选中要复制的数据。
  • 使用复制快捷键(Ctrl + C)或右键单击并选择“复制”选项。
  • 切换到第二个Excel文档的窗口。
  • 将光标移动到要粘贴数据的位置。
  • 使用粘贴快捷键(Ctrl + V)或右键单击并选择“粘贴”选项。

通过这种方式,您可以轻松地将数据从一个Excel文档复制到另一个Excel文档中。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4906034

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部